Antique oil painting on panel, interior scene, Flemish school, in a richly gilded frame.
Atmospheric antique oil painting on wooden panel, attributed to the Flemish school and executed in the style of the Dutch Golden Age masters of the 17th century. The scene shows a domestic interior where a party sits at a table laid with white linen, while a maid in yellow approaches with a tray. Through a window on the left, daylight pours in, and in the background a second figure can be seen by a cabinet. The dark, warm color palette and the domestic setting are characteristic of this genre.
On the back of the panel there is a handwritten note: "Restauratie 1985, Francine", with an inventory number. In addition, a name is written on the back of the frame, though it is poorly legible; see the photos.
The painting is housed in a richly decorated gilded stucco frame with floral and graceful motifs, appropriate to the style of the work. The panel itself measures 30.5 x 36 cm. The work including the frame measures 51.5 x 59 cm. This frame is in turn placed in an extra black surround or housing of 54 x 59 x 8 cm, possibly for protection during transport or presentation.
The work is in good condition, with traces of previous restoration and light signs of wear consistent with age. A atmospheric decorative object for lovers of classical painting.
